Revolutionizing Learning & Training Videos: How AI is Set to Replace Marketers in the Information Technology & Services Industry The rapid advancement of artificial intelligence (AI) has had a significant impact on various industries, and the information technology and services sector is no exception. In recent years, AI has started to revolutionize the way learning and training videos are created, raising questions about the future role of marketers in this field. Traditionally, marketers have played a crucial role in creating informative and engaging videos for learning and training purposes. They have been responsible for identifying the target audience, crafting compelling narratives, and ensuring the videos effectively communicate the desired message. However, AI technology is now poised to take over these tasks, offering a more efficient and cost-effective solution. One of the primary advantages of using AI in the creation of learning and training videos is its ability to analyze vast amounts of data quickly. By feeding AI algorithms with relevant information about the target audience, industry trends, and specific learning objectives, AI can generate personalized and tailored content at scale. This not only saves time but also ensures that the videos resonate with the learners, leading to a more effective learning experience. Another significant benefit of AI-generated videos is their adaptability. AI algorithms can analyze learners' progress and adjust the content dynamically based on their individual needs. This personalized approach helps learners stay engaged and motivated, as the videos are tailored to their specific knowledge gaps and learning pace. Moreover, AI can also incorporate real-time feedback and assessments, allowing learners to track their progress and receive immediate guidance. Furthermore, AI offers a level of consistency and accuracy that is challenging to achieve manually. Human marketers may inadvertently introduce biases or inconsistencies in their videos, leading to misinformation or confusion among learners. AI, on the other hand, follows a predefined set of rules and data, ensuring that the content remains accurate and unbiased. This reliability is crucial, especially in industries like information technology and services, where accuracy and up-to-date knowledge are paramount. While AI offers numerous advantages in learning and training video creation, it is important to note that it does not completely replace marketers. Marketers still play a crucial role in understanding the needs of the learners, identifying learning objectives, and defining the overall strategy. They are responsible for curating the data and setting the parameters for AI algorithms to generate the content. Additionally, marketers can leverage AI-generated videos to focus on higher-level tasks, such as analyzing the learners' feedback and optimizing the learning experience. In conclusion, AI is set to revolutionize the creation of learning and training videos in the information technology and services industry. By leveraging AI's ability to analyze vast amounts of data, personalize content, and ensure accuracy, organizations can provide more effective and engaging learning experiences for their employees. While AI may replace some of the tasks traditionally performed by marketers, it also opens up new opportunities for them to focus on higher-level strategy and optimization. The collaboration between AI technology and marketers is likely to shape the future of learning and training videos, enhancing the overall learning experience in the industry.
